Output 907fb9e5489a90aeb1c5c8f14396ea45954c2e87a2ce26a6056d86b054f57160:2

value
18448036
script pubkey
OP_0 OP_PUSHBYTES_20 389ad2050da70e29c0f59dae12c5d0263e9b7e24
address
bc1q8zddypgd5u8zns84nkhp93wsyclfkl3yuewak5
transaction
907fb9e5489a90aeb1c5c8f14396ea45954c2e87a2ce26a6056d86b054f57160
spent
true